How to survive the flight to Berfa?
If you're not prepared, traveling can be a real challenge. But don't hit the panic button just yet. Follow these tips and tricks for a hassle-free start to your time in Berfa.What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• A plane ride can be a stress-free experience if you take the right things. Firstly, you'll want a few basic toiletries, such as deodorant and a toothbrush, a spare change of clothes and a good read. Secondly, make room in your hand luggage for your electronic devices, chargers, your important medications and maybe a proper neck pillow too. Last, but definitely not least, be sure to bring your passport, travel documents and your credit cards.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Double-check that you don't have a sharp object lurking in your carry-on luggage. Other banned items include explosive or flammable products, such as aerosol cans and bleach, and liquids and gels in containers lar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ters).

What to wear on a flight:

  • The best way to ensure a comfortable flight is often as simple as your choice in clothes. Prepare for changes in temperature by bringing layers. This will keep you nice and warm if the cabin gets chilly. Shoes like flip flops and heels are best left for other occasions. Instead, go for flat, closed-toed footwear like sneakers. Your feet will thank you for it.
  • Caused by sustained periods of inactivity, DVT (deep vein thrombosis) is a blood clot condition that can affect some passengers during long flights. But the great news is there are ways to lower your risk of developing it. Keep your fluids up, get up and wander the aisles as often as you can and wear compression socks or tights.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Berfa?
Being prepared before you arrive at the airport will make your trip to Berfa quick and painless. Read through our handy tips and tricks for a swift journey past security:

  • Be sure to keep your passport and travel documents handy. They're the first items you'll be asked to present to security.
  • Next up, both you and your carry-on luggage will be X-rayed. To make the process quick and painless, take off anything that is likely to trigger the alarm. Items such as your belt, coat and earphones will be required to go through the machine.
  • All your electronics, including your phone and laptop, must also be separately scanned.
  • Traveling with your favorite hand and nail cream? As long as it's in a container no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and it's stored in a clear zip-lock bag, you can keep it with you in your carry-on.
  • There's a chance you'll be required to take your shoes off for scanning, so wearing slip-on sneakers is always a clever idea.
  • Avoid taking prohibited items in your carry-on bag. If you have any sharp or pointed objects, pack them safely away in your checked suitcase. They won't be allowed on board.
